I needed divine help. ⁣

It was a unique life experience where I knew something really difficult was about to happen. ⁣

There wasn’t much I could do to prepare other than plead for heavenly assistance. ⁣

I joined my voice with David when he said:⁣

“Draw nigh unto my soul”. (Psalms 69:18) ⁣

I quite literally said in prayer, “I’m going to need Your strength a lot more. I need You closer to me.”⁣

I put the responsibility on the Lord. ⁣

He needed to come closer to me to help support me through this tough time, right?⁣

The Spirit often speaks to me by putting whole sentences or phrases right in my mind. ⁣

The response I immediately got was:⁣

“I’m already here. You know what you need to do to draw more of My power into your life.”⁣

It was exactly the message that I needed to hear. ⁣

How do we get Jesus to draw closer to us?⁣

We draw closer to Him. ⁣

Since that moment, I’ve tried to make the Savior an even higher priority in my life. ⁣

I’ve tried to make more time for Him, I’ve tried to speak with Him more, and I’ve tried to speak about Him more. ⁣

I’ve drawn closer to Him, even though it’s seemed like He has drawn closer to me. ⁣

And other times, I’ve forgotten. ⁣

I’ve thought, “Where is He? Why do I feel so out of touch?”⁣

And then I remember. ⁣

Jesus Christ and Heavenly Father are certainly not out of touch with me. ⁣

As a caveat, I do fully believe that the Lord can send extra measures of His Spirit when we are in need, and I don’t believe that we can force spiritual experiences by our actions. ⁣

God is divine and can do according to His desires. ⁣

But I needed the gentle but firm reminder that day that when I’m hoping that God will come closer to me, there’s probably only one of us who is actually being distant. ⁣

It’s on me, with righteous and pure intent, to seek Him out. ⁣

To stretch out my hand to accept His help that’s been there all along.
